## Configuration

The Larkwell component library (internal name: Bramblekit) publishes versioned bundles to our private registry. Version pins are enforced via `BRAMBLEKIT_VERSION_POLICY`, which should be set to `strict` in all reviewed environments. Consumers resolve packages through the Hollis proxy, and audit logs record every fetch. Note that the publish pipeline signs each release, and verification happens at install time. For the registry to accept authenticated version queries, the environment file must include the following line:

sealed setting: VAULT_KEY5=54f99

# Session Handling — Murrelet Audio Guide

Sessions start when a visitor scans a gallery beacon. Token TTL: 45 min, renewed on each track request. No refresh tokens; expired sessions force a new beacon scan. Sessions are device-scoped, never account-scoped, so logout is just token deletion. Review point: renewal must not extend past museum closing time (server-enforced). For local review runs, the mock gateway accepts a single static session credential, which is included below.

session JWT of tadup-kaguf = eyJhbGciOiJIUzI1NiIsInR5cCI6IkpXVCJ9.eyJzdWIiOiItNz4V3In0.KrZCeqpk

## Changelog — Ticktrace 1.9

### Renamed: DRIFT_API_TOKEN
During the cron drift investigation we found plugins confusing this variable with the metrics token, so it has been renamed to indicate it authorizes drift-report uploads specifically. Plugin authors must read the new name from 1.9 onward; the old name is ignored without warning. Sample env files in the SDK are updated. In your deployment env file, the drift-report upload secret is set on the next line.

env line for fawef-taguf: VAULT_KEY13=a9695905a9a90

ALERT: KioskGuard watchdog on Brimley Station units restarted the Lumivend app 4 times in 30 minutes, exceeding the 3-restart threshold. Affected build: 5.2.1, rolled out Tuesday. Watchdog logs show heartbeat timeouts during the payment screen transition. Units remain in degraded mode; attract loop disabled. Recommend holding the 5.2.2 promotion until root cause confirmed. If restarts continue past the next window, page on-call. For rollout questions, reach the platform team here.

escalation mailbox, bafog-fafog: ulador@paliqlabs.internal